Transaction 6538354e3ab26b6637ae725f0a953b32c376c12e58661459d167658294a52f42
1 Input
1 Output
-
6538354e3ab26b6637ae725f0a953b32c376c12e58661459d167658294a52f42:0
- value
- 454544798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e01837007448da08ab013bd0be1ed3280903b46 OP_EQUAL
- address
- MNJcotpS45C7tioEmquTixD5ffXPHbN3tp